Block 807,626
Block Hash
ec80779a1f173ea9c644c5c4c72fb267b286ceb365b6827af5e49844989147e6
Previous Block Hash
9a288e131bfe0e8be851a8b6b745363f74dda8464a0d3ae3fa717d0675293c6e
Mined
Transactions
3
Difficulty
57.07 M
Size
623 bytes
Transactions (3)
1 input, 1 output
10,000.00452
PEPE
1 input, 2 outputs
12,044.05786
PEPE
1 input, 2 outputs
2,140.77708
PEPE